Output 59ecf9c7cac4d6fa19d845b405fa68d2d470358f830ae63cfe6b843966cd4c3e:0

value
41391296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5730573f6d5477334beb59f9d096d5e3d59249d3 OP_EQUAL
address
39e2d1cqtzRK8WBcc7P5p4dK7U8nBs5ysd
transaction
59ecf9c7cac4d6fa19d845b405fa68d2d470358f830ae63cfe6b843966cd4c3e
spent
true